Creamy Lemon Feta Pasta Recipe

Creamy Lemon Feta Pasta is a luscious, tangy, and flavorful dish featuring roasted feta cheese blended with olive oil, garlic, and fresh lemon juice to create a silky sauce that clings perfectly to al dente pasta. Garnished with fresh herbs and cracked black pepper, this easy-to-make recipe delivers a comforting Mediterranean-inspired meal in under 30 minutes.

Ingredients

Pasta & Sauce

  • 8 oz pasta such as penne or rigatoni
  • 1 block feta cheese 7-8 oz, full-fat in brine
  • 0.33 cup extra-virgin olive oil plus more for drizzling
  • 3-4 cloves garlic thinly sliced
  • 1 tsp red pepper flakes
  • 1 large lemon zest and juice
  • 0.5 cup pasta water reserved

Garnish

  • 1 handful fresh herbs dill, parsley, or basil
  • freshly cracked black pepper

Instructions

  1. Preheat and Prepare Ingredients: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Zest and juice the lemon and set aside. Thinly slice the garlic cloves carefully to ensure even roasting.
  2. Roast the Feta and Aromatics: Place the block of feta cheese in an oven-safe baking dish. Pour 1/3 cup of extra-virgin olive oil around the feta. Scatter the sliced garlic and red pepper flakes in the oil around the cheese. Drizzle some additional olive oil over the feta and season with freshly cracked black pepper. Roast in the oven for 20 minutes until the feta softens and develops a light golden color.
  3. Cook the Pasta: While the feta roasts, cook the pasta in the boiling salted water until al dente according to package instructions. Before draining, reserve 1/2 cup of the starchy pasta water. Drain the pasta thoroughly.
  4. Create the Creamy Sauce: Remove the baking dish with feta from the oven. Immediately add the lemon juice and half of the lemon zest to the hot feta and olive oil mixture. Use a fork or whisk to vigorously mash and blend the feta, olive oil, garlic, and lemon juice together into a smooth, creamy sauce.
  5. Toss Pasta with Sauce: Add the hot drained pasta directly into the baking dish with the feta sauce. Pour in 1/4 cup of the reserved pasta water and toss thoroughly with tongs or a large spoon. Add more pasta water as needed to achieve a silky, evenly coated consistency.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Taste the dish and adjust seasoning as needed, though additional salt is likely unnecessary. Garnish with the remaining lemon zest, a handful of fresh herbs such as dill, parsley, or basil, and an extra drizzle of olive oil. Serve immediately while warm.

Notes

  • Use full-fat feta in brine for the creamiest texture and best flavor.
  • Reserve pasta water carefully as it helps achieve the perfect sauce consistency.
  • Adjust red pepper flakes to your preferred spice level.
  • Fresh herbs like dill, parsley, or basil provide bright herbal notes – feel free to mix or substitute based on availability.
  • This dish is best served immediately as the sauce thickens when cooled.
  • If you prefer a smoother sauce, use a whisk vigorously or a fork to mash the feta completely.
  • For a gluten-free version, substitute the pasta with gluten-free pasta variety.
